Origins
The history of matcha tea dates back to the Chinese Tang Dynasty (618–907 AD). You may be interested to know that at that time, people steamed tea leaves and formed them into tea bricks, mainly for easy storage and trade. Tea was prepared by roasting these bricks, grinding them into powder, and mixing them with hot water and salt.
The practice of whisking finely ground tea leaves in hot water dates back to the Song dynasty (960–1279 AD). Tradition has it that Zen Buddhist monks adopted the ritual and brought it to Japan around 1191. And while the popularity of ‘powdered tea’ declined over time in China, in Japan matcha became an integral part of Zen monasteries and the upper classes.
As a result, the production of matcha-type green teas attracted a huge number of Japanese tea gardens. These include those in the Kagoshima region at the southern tip of Japan. It’s currently the second largest tea producer in the country, right after Shizuoka. Kagoshima is characterized by active volcanoes that enrich the soil with extremely fertile volcanic ash. Thanks to its subtropical climate with mild temperatures and high rainfall, it’s literally a promised land for tea growers. A significant portion of the tea plantations operate under organic farming methods and produce high-quality matcha, prized for its rich flavor and aroma.

Instructions for preparation
- Add half a teaspoon of matcha per 100ml of boiled water (75°C).
- For best results, heat up your glass or bowl before adding matcha powder.
- Whisk or stir vigorously until a thick foam forms.
- Optionally, use a milk frother.
